After weeks of wrangled negotations and a stand off Khruschev-Kennedy style I have finally landed a job. I will now be working here: ILA Vietnam in District 1. 

For those of you not in the know ILA Vietnam is the English Language school we did our CELTA certificate with. The branch we will be working in is different to the training centre in that it is much smaller, (and we feel) more intimate.

ILA was our first choice primarily because of its amazing resources, support and benefits package. For first time teachers like us it seems the best launchpad for teaching in Vietnam.
